Solutions are presented as using the least memory and the fastest execution time. It also takes the top 10 most recent solutions from each language. If you want to limit to a specific index, click the "Solved" button and go to that problem.
ContestId |
Name |
Phase |
Frozen |
Duration (Seconds) |
Relative Time |
Start Time |
|---|---|---|---|---|---|---|
| 2010 | Testing Round 19 (Div. 3) | FINISHED | False | 2700 | 51528323 | Aug. 28, 2024, 8:35 p.m. |
Solved |
Index |
Name |
Type |
Tags |
Community Tag |
Rating |
|---|---|---|---|---|---|---|
| ( 4562 ) | C2 | Message Transmission Error (hard version) | PROGRAMMING | hashing strings two pointers | 1700 |
This is a more difficult version of the problem. It differs from the easy one only by the constraints. At the Berland State University, the local network between servers does not always operate without errors. When transmitting two identical messages consecutively, an error may occur, resulting in the two messages merging into one. In this merging, the end of the first message coincides with the beginning of the second. Of course, the merging can only occur at identical characters. The length of the merging must be a positive number less than the length of the message text. For example, when transmitting two messages " abrakadabra " consecutively, it is possible that it will be transmitted with the described type of error, resulting in a message like " abrakadabrabrakadabra " or " abrakadabrakadabra ' (in the first case, the merging occurred at one character, and in the second case, at four). Given the received message t , determine if it is possible that this is the result of an error of the described type in the operation of the local network, and if so, determine a possible value of s . A situation where two messages completely overlap each other should not be considered an error. For example, if the received message is " abcd ", it should be considered that there is no error in it. Similarly, simply appending one message after another is not a sign of an error. For instance, if the received message is " abcabc ", it should also be considered that there is no error in it. The input consists of a single non-empty string t , consisting of lowercase letters of the Latin alphabet. The length of the string t does not exceed 4·10 5 characters. If the message t cannot contain an error, output " NO " (without quotes) in a single line of output. Otherwise, in the first line, output " YES " (without quotes), and in the next line, output the string s — a possible message that could have led to the error. If there are multiple possible answers, any of them is accep |
Submission Id |
Author(s) |
Index |
Submitted |
Verdict |
Language |
Test Set |
Tests Passed |
Time taken (ms) |
Memory Consumed (bytes) |
Tags |
Rating |
|---|---|---|---|---|---|---|---|---|---|---|---|
| 278568615 | A1ternate | C2 | Aug. 28, 2024, 9:39 p.m. | OK | C# 10 | TESTS | 151 | 109 | 3174400 | 1700 | |
| 278591398 | LSD | C2 | Aug. 29, 2024, 5:36 a.m. | OK | C++17 (GCC 7-32) | TESTS | 156 | 62 | 102400 | 1700 | |
| 278579151 | iagozag | C2 | Aug. 29, 2024, 1:59 a.m. | OK | C++17 (GCC 7-32) | TESTS | 156 | 62 | 102400 | 1700 | |
| 278578982 | ma369 | C2 | Aug. 29, 2024, 1:55 a.m. | OK | C++17 (GCC 7-32) | TESTS | 156 | 62 | 102400 | 1700 | |
| 278575526 | Calebam | C2 | Aug. 29, 2024, 12:32 a.m. | OK | C++17 (GCC 7-32) | TESTS | 156 | 62 | 102400 | 1700 | |
| 278573553 | devecent | C2 | Aug. 28, 2024, 11:34 p.m. | OK | C++17 (GCC 7-32) | TESTS | 156 | 62 | 102400 | 1700 | |
| 278570268 | Salah7_a | C2 | Aug. 28, 2024, 10:11 p.m. | OK | C++17 (GCC 7-32) | TESTS | 155 | 62 | 512000 | 1700 | |
| 278577721 | Fusu | C2 | Aug. 29, 2024, 1:28 a.m. | OK | C++17 (GCC 7-32) | TESTS | 156 | 62 | 614400 | 1700 | |
| 278570999 | Yagyesh_Anshul | C2 | Aug. 28, 2024, 10:29 p.m. | OK | C++17 (GCC 7-32) | TESTS | 156 | 62 | 614400 | 1700 | |
| 278570087 | Aasneh | C2 | Aug. 28, 2024, 10:07 p.m. | OK | C++17 (GCC 7-32) | TESTS | 155 | 62 | 614400 | 1700 | |
| 278569428 | techwiz911 | C2 | Aug. 28, 2024, 9:54 p.m. | OK | C++17 (GCC 7-32) | TESTS | 153 | 62 | 614400 | 1700 | |
| 278584338 | GodNiu | C2 | Aug. 29, 2024, 3:41 a.m. | OK | C++20 (GCC 13-64) | TESTS | 156 | 46 | 2457600 | 1700 | |
| 278576266 | 9756 | C2 | Aug. 29, 2024, 12:54 a.m. | OK | C++20 (GCC 13-64) | TESTS | 156 | 46 | 5734400 | 1700 | |
| 278579957 | luishgh | C2 | Aug. 29, 2024, 2:17 a.m. | OK | C++20 (GCC 13-64) | TESTS | 156 | 61 | 102400 | 1700 | |
| 278586813 | infty12 | C2 | Aug. 29, 2024, 4:26 a.m. | OK | C++20 (GCC 13-64) | TESTS | 156 | 61 | 614400 | 1700 | |
| 278582749 | Red0 | C2 | Aug. 29, 2024, 3:12 a.m. | OK | C++20 (GCC 13-64) | TESTS | 156 | 61 | 1228800 | 1700 | |
| 278578971 | LeeMinHoon | C2 | Aug. 29, 2024, 1:55 a.m. | OK | C++20 (GCC 13-64) | TESTS | 156 | 61 | 2457600 | 1700 | |
| 278581915 | RainbowDragon | C2 | Aug. 29, 2024, 2:56 a.m. | OK | C++20 (GCC 13-64) | TESTS | 156 | 61 | 3276800 | 1700 | |
| 278591440 | suki._.dayo | C2 | Aug. 29, 2024, 5:37 a.m. | OK | C++20 (GCC 13-64) | TESTS | 156 | 62 | 102400 | 1700 | |
| 278591313 | Pedestrian... | C2 | Aug. 29, 2024, 5:35 a.m. | OK | C++20 (GCC 13-64) | TESTS | 156 | 62 | 102400 | 1700 | |
| 278586095 | Chill_xy | C2 | Aug. 29, 2024, 4:13 a.m. | OK | C++20 (GCC 13-64) | TESTS | 156 | 62 | 102400 | 1700 | |
| 278569842 | nikolashami | C2 | Aug. 28, 2024, 10:02 p.m. | OK | C++23 (GCC 14-64, msys2) | TESTS | 155 | 61 | 7680000 | 1700 | |
| 278591856 | Dash_____ | C2 | Aug. 29, 2024, 5:42 a.m. | OK | C++23 (GCC 14-64, msys2) | TESTS | 156 | 62 | 11980800 | 1700 | |
| 278575994 | Z_drj | C2 | Aug. 29, 2024, 12:46 a.m. | OK | C++23 (GCC 14-64, msys2) | TESTS | 156 | 62 | 15155200 | 1700 | |
| 278582155 | _Taitan | C2 | Aug. 29, 2024, 3:01 a.m. | OK | C++23 (GCC 14-64, msys2) | TESTS | 156 | 62 | 21504000 | 1700 | |
| 278569353 | BluoCaroot | C2 | Aug. 28, 2024, 9:53 p.m. | OK | C++23 (GCC 14-64, msys2) | TESTS | 153 | 77 | 7680000 | 1700 | |
| 278564657 | JhoZzel_ | C2 | Aug. 28, 2024, 9:13 p.m. | OK | C++23 (GCC 14-64, msys2) | TESTS | 151 | 77 | 7680000 | 1700 | |
| 278563586 | Highty | C2 | Aug. 28, 2024, 9:03 p.m. | OK | C++23 (GCC 14-64, msys2) | TESTS | 151 | 77 | 7680000 | 1700 | |
| 278561754 | Adham_Ibrahim | C2 | Aug. 28, 2024, 8:47 p.m. | OK | C++23 (GCC 14-64, msys2) | TESTS | 151 | 77 | 7680000 | 1700 | |
| 278569683 | saadkhurshidqureshi | C2 | Aug. 28, 2024, 9:59 p.m. | OK | C++23 (GCC 14-64, msys2) | TESTS | 155 | 77 | 10342400 | 1700 | |
| 278561078 | arseny2606 | C2 | Aug. 28, 2024, 8:43 p.m. | OK | C++23 (GCC 14-64, msys2) | TESTS | 151 | 77 | 10342400 | 1700 | |
| 278591405 | cpp10 | C2 | Aug. 29, 2024, 5:36 a.m. | OK | Java 21 | TESTS | 156 | 265 | 1638400 | 1700 | |
| 278591522 | cpp10 | C2 | Aug. 29, 2024, 5:38 a.m. | OK | Java 21 | TESTS | 156 | 312 | 1433600 | 1700 | |
| 278590706 | iamalizaidi | C2 | Aug. 29, 2024, 5:27 a.m. | OK | Java 21 | TESTS | 156 | 342 | 1126400 | 1700 | |
| 278562035 | Eslam_Ahmed | C2 | Aug. 28, 2024, 8:49 p.m. | OK | Java 8 | TESTS | 151 | 249 | 10137600 | 1700 | |
| 278570619 | Yousef_Badr | C2 | Aug. 28, 2024, 10:19 p.m. | OK | Java 8 | TESTS | 155 | 405 | 77619200 | 1700 | |
| 278569173 | bnmanubharadwaj | C2 | Aug. 28, 2024, 9:49 p.m. | OK | JavaScript | TESTS | 152 | 108 | 7884800 | 1700 | |
| 278561731 | MDSPro | C2 | Aug. 28, 2024, 8:47 p.m. | OK | PyPy 3 | TESTS | 151 | 155 | 7987200 | 1700 | |
| 278565111 | HuTao_Oya_OyaOya | C2 | Aug. 28, 2024, 9:17 p.m. | OK | PyPy 3 | TESTS | 151 | 156 | 5632000 | 1700 | |
| 278579917 | ranamubashirhassan | C2 | Aug. 29, 2024, 2:16 a.m. | OK | PyPy 3-64 | TESTS | 156 | 108 | 6860800 | 1700 | |
| 278587752 | RinkaSnow | C2 | Aug. 29, 2024, 4:42 a.m. | OK | PyPy 3-64 | TESTS | 156 | 108 | 7782400 | 1700 | |
| 278560891 | eugenechka.boyko.2_0-0 | C2 | Aug. 28, 2024, 8:41 p.m. | OK | PyPy 3-64 | TESTS | 151 | 109 | 6860800 | 1700 | |
| 278564562 | hitthheerree | C2 | Aug. 28, 2024, 9:12 p.m. | OK | PyPy 3-64 | TESTS | 151 | 124 | 7372800 | 1700 | |
| 278570064 | verstrapp_1 | C2 | Aug. 28, 2024, 10:07 p.m. | OK | PyPy 3-64 | TESTS | 155 | 140 | 16896000 | 1700 | |
| 278560794 | anango | C2 | Aug. 28, 2024, 8:40 p.m. | OK | PyPy 3-64 | TESTS | 151 | 156 | 11059200 | 1700 | |
| 278588113 | LightHouse1 | C2 | Aug. 29, 2024, 4:48 a.m. | OK | PyPy 3-64 | TESTS | 156 | 202 | 32051200 | 1700 | |
| 278563161 | shash4321 | C2 | Aug. 28, 2024, 8:59 p.m. | OK | PyPy 3-64 | TESTS | 151 | 202 | 143052800 | 1700 | |
| 278564084 | hxu10 | C2 | Aug. 28, 2024, 9:07 p.m. | OK | PyPy 3-64 | TESTS | 151 | 358 | 30822400 | 1700 | |
| 278585940 | phantrongnghia510 | C2 | Aug. 29, 2024, 4:10 a.m. | OK | Python 3 | TESTS | 156 | 156 | 17305600 | 1700 | |
| 278565408 | Deadlift_guy_0010 | C2 | Aug. 28, 2024, 9:19 p.m. | OK | Python 3 | TESTS | 151 | 359 | 16486400 | 1700 |
Back to search problems